Will an Olds 307 engine and turbo 350 tranny fit right in to my 82 Trans Am??
Im building a 350 chev but I want to stick this olds engine in untill the 350s done. The olds engine is out of a 79 buick.
Im worried about the exhaust manifold clearance.

The exhaust on the motor will probably fit into the chassis, but it certainly won't hook up to what's in the car.
You'd have to adapt that; get a different driveshaft; move the battery to the other side of the car; deal with a completely different wiring arrangement; and no doubt a few other minor details. All in all not a very direct swap, and not free or really even cheap. I'd recommend spending your money and effort on the 350 instead.
